## Dedup pipeline checks

Welcome aboard. Signalfold's deduplicator collapses repeated alerts using a fingerprint hash stored in the `dedupe_cache` table. If duplicates leak through, verify the cache TTL job is running and that fingerprints match across regions. To query the cache directly, connect using the connection string below.

primary connection of yagep-kahip = redis://giliel_svc:zYiKsLL2PLpfPL@db-348f.xolmarsys.corp:5432/fenwyn

Break-glass access: SquatWatch

Quick notes for the weekly sync. SquatWatch is our typo-squatting package scanner; if it goes dark, malicious lookalike packages can slip into the Pellbrook registry, so we keep a break-glass path. Use it only when both regular admins are unreachable and the scanner has been down 30+ minutes. Grab the sealed envelope from the ops locker, log the incident in #squatwatch-alerts, and ping whoever's on call. The break-glass login prompts for the passphrase below.

unlock words, tagaf-tawif: quenys-zordor-aldius-caswyn

// AUTOCOMPLETE_DEBOUNCE_MS — Pinmark address widget.
// Release manager: do not bump this above 250 without checking the
// Glenharbor latency dashboard first. Lower values hammer the suggest
// endpoint; higher values make the widget feel dead on fast typists.
// 180 was tuned against the Q3 field study and is load-bearing for
// the SLA. Any change must ship behind the staged-rollout flag and
// be noted in the release sheet. The value below reflects the last
// verified build.

trace token, fafog-kageg: htk4_98e6